Output 3743c34c233417e4df5d4032f51263dfbe01d193ddd73ac91a01a92b50635578:6

value
772550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39a407e57e2fa09cf9b6cbeb527b9d68f86189a OP_EQUAL
address
3Gc4rRYReGKSkDQ8CA6zMvRYpFY4zcrft6
transaction
3743c34c233417e4df5d4032f51263dfbe01d193ddd73ac91a01a92b50635578
spent
true